Endometrial ablation is a minimally invasive procedure designed to treat abnormal uterine bleeding by removing or destroying the endometrial lining of the uterus. This treatment is typically performed by a gynaecologist, a specialist in women's reproductive health. If left untreated, conditions such as heavy menstrual bleeding can lead to complications including anaemia, chronic pain, and a significant impact on quality of life. Understanding the underlying causes, which may include fibroids or hormonal imbalances, is crucial for effective management and treatment.
For an initial consultation regarding endometrial ablation, you can expect fees to range from £200 to £300. The overall costs for the procedure itself can vary significantly depending on the hospital, location, and complexity of the case.
